示例:利用SqlConnection连接只读副本,SqlCommand读取数据;或配置Entity Framework的DbContext使用副本连接字符串。
在这个特定的for循环上下文中,i:=0仅仅是为了初始化计数器i,并在每次循环迭代中通过i+=1递增。
循环遍历结果: 使用 while 循环遍历结果集,并使用 fetch_assoc() 函数获取每一行数据作为关联数组。
示例: #include <format> #include <string> <p>std::string toHex(int num) { return std::format("{:x}", num); // 小写 // return std::format("{:X}", num); // 大写 }</p>注意:需启用C++20并确保编译器支持std::format(如GCC 13+、MSVC)。
可以使用循环遍历数据数组,逐行逐列写入。
通常情况下,在包含文件中直接赋值给变量即可,无需使用global。
合理配置邮件驱动并结合队列机制,能显著提升应用响应速度和邮件送达可靠性。
读取JSON文件:使用 with open(json_file, 'r') as f: 打开JSON文件,并使用 json.load(f) 将其加载到 data 变量中。
通过以管理员身份运行安装程序,大多数因权限不足导致的Python安装问题都可以得到有效解决。
通过示例代码,您将学会创建结构清晰、易于维护的web页面,并有效处理不同页面的渲染需求。
立即学习“go语言免费学习笔记(深入)”; func TestHelloHandler_UnitStyle(t *testing.T) { req := httptest.NewRequest("GET", "/", nil) recorder := httptest.NewRecorder() handler := http.HandlerFunc(helloHandler) handler.ServeHTTP(recorder, req) if recorder.Code != http.StatusOK { t.Errorf("expected status %d, got %d", http.StatusOK, recorder.Code) } var data map[string]string if err := json.Unmarshal(recorder.Body.Bytes(), &data); err != nil { t.Fatalf("failed to unmarshal response: %v", err) } if msg, exists := data["message"]; !exists || msg != "Hello, World!" { t.Errorf(`expected message "Hello, World!", got "%s"`, msg) } } 验证响应头、状态码和错误处理 除了响应体,你也可以检查响应头、内容类型、重定向等信息。
虽然在Go 1.18之前自定义合并函数会受限于泛型缺失而需为每种类型单独实现,但现在通过泛型可以编写出类型安全的通用合并函数,提升代码复用性。
可以使用r.Form.Get("username")来获取名为"username"的表单字段的值。
PHP数组过滤时如何处理键名与键值?
副标题1 如何安全地处理PHP接口中的用户输入,防止SQL注入和XSS攻击?
*sql.Rows 对象是一个迭代器,需要通过 rows.Next() 方法遍历结果集,并通过 rows.Scan() 方法将当前行的数据扫描到变量中。
在php中,处理字符串是日常开发中常见的任务之一。
解决方案:修改模板文件 解决此问题的核心在于定位并修改 product-cover-thumbnails.tpl 文件中的相关代码。
Go语言中数组和切片是处理序列数据的两种核心结构,但它们在底层机制、大小管理和使用场景上有着本质区别。
然而,需要注意安全性、错误处理、部署时间以及潜在的成本问题。
本文链接:http://www.futuraserramenti.com/314017_82210a.html